Maid Simple House Cleaning by Maid Brigade Offers Financial Incentives for Veterans

Residential Cleaning Franchise Becomes VetFran Proud Supporter

September 26, 2013 // Franchising.com // ATLANTA - Military veterans, active duty military, and military spouses interested in franchising can now take advantage of discounts offered by Maid Simple House Cleaning. The company is offering veterans and their families 15 percent off the initial franchise fee. Maid Simple is a new home-based franchise model created by the residential cleaning leader, Maid Brigade.

“We are committed to providing veterans with opportunities to re-enter the workforce as small business owners,” says Joel Lazarovitz, vice president of franchise recruitment for Maid Simple. “As thousands of Americans return home from war, we acknowledge the characteristics they have acquired during their military careers that make them outstanding franchisees – strong leadership skills, a dedication to quality and hard work, and the ability to excel at operational management.”

One out of every seven franchises in the United States is owned by a veteran, as found by a study conducted by the International Franchise Association (IFA). The franchise industry has committed to hiring and recruiting 80,000 veterans and military spouses as team members and franchise business owners through 2014, according to the IFA VetFran initiative. Maid Simple is a Proud Supporter of the VetFran program, which helps returning service members access franchise opportunities through training, financial assistance, and industry support.

“After my career in the military ended, I transitioned into franchising because the structure it provided was a great fit for me,” says Tai Jeffries, owner of Maid Simple of Fort Wayne, Ind. “As a former airman/soldier, I am skilled at following instructions and completing tasks. By following my franchise procedures, I know I will be successful.”

Available for $29,500 including the $10,000 franchise fee, Maid Simple provides qualified veterans with a complete franchise package that includes a customer acquisition program, national sales center that handles customer scheduling, billing and payment processing, and ongoing training and marketing support. USA Today ranks Maid Brigade a Top 50 Franchise Opportunity for Veterans.

About Maid Brigade/Maid Simple House Cleaning

Established in 1979, Maid Brigade is North America’s leading cleaning franchise with more than 400 franchise locations in the United States and Canada. The company launched a new home-based, low investment franchise model, Maid Simple House Cleaning, in 2012. Maid Brigade is ranked a Top Global, Top 100, and Top 500 Franchise by Entrepreneur magazine, a Top 50 Franchise opportunity for Minorities and Veterans by USA Today, and a Top 25 Franchise for Hispanics by the World Franchising Network. Maid Brigade is the only Green Clean Certified® maid services company in the world.
